Call center operator: Let's start with the fact that the Belgian language does not exist. There are three officially recognized languages ​​in the country: French, Dutch, German.


Many also speak English well, which, by the way, is the best language to use when communicating with locals. Creatives are best done in French, as Belgium was under French-speaking rule for a long time. Therefore, this language provides greater relevance to the audience.
